: Use a tool like WinRAR, 7-Zip, or ZArchiver to extract the folder. You should see a folder named after the region code (e.g., ULUS10234 ). Inside, there will be files like PARAM.SFO and DATA.BIN . Locate the PPSSPP Save Directory :
